欢迎来到天天文库
浏览记录
ID:44188341
大小:2.02 MB
页数:245页
时间:2019-10-19
《access2003计算机等级考试理论知识》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、计算机二级Access2003数据库程序设计数据库基础知识第一章数据库系统一.数据库的概念数据库(DB)数据数据库应用系统描述事物的符号记录。包括数据内容,数据形式。结构化的相关数据集合.包括描述事物的数据本身及相关事物之间的关系。利用数据库系统资源开发的面向某一类实际应用的软件系统.数据库管理系统(DBMS)为数据库的建立、使用和维护而配置的软件数据库系统(DBS)引进数据库技术后的计算机系统。实现有组织、动态的存储大量相关数据,提供数据处理和信息资源共享的便利手段硬件系统、数据库集合、数据库管
2、理系统及相关软件、数据库管理员(DBA)数据库系统数据库管理系统(DBMS)应用程序数据库数据库管理员(DBA)操作系统硬件数据库系统的特点实现数据共享,减少数据冗余对数据的定义和描述已从应用程序中分离出来,通过DBMS统一管理。2.采用特定的数据模型DBS不仅可以表示事物内部数据项之间的联系,而且可以表示事物与事物之间的联系,从而反映出现实世界事物之间的联系。3.具有较高的数据独立性DBMS提供映像功能,实现了应用程序对数据的总体逻辑结构,物理存储结构之间较高的独立性。4.有统一的数据控制功能D
3、BMS提供必要的保护措施,包括并发访问控制功能,数据的安全性控制功能和数据的完整性控制功能。数据库系统的特点数据模型一.实体描述:客观存在并相互区别的事物。描述实体的特性。:属性的集合表示的实体的类型。:同类型的实体的集合。实体实体的属性:实体型实体集二.实体间联系及种类一对一一对多多对多教务处教务科教材科师资科科研处人事处管理系······即树型。用来描述有层次联系的事物。反映客观事物之间一对多的联系。校部层次模型三.数据模型简介数据模型:是数据库管理系统用来表示实体及实体间联系的方法。一个具体
4、的数据模型应当正确地反映出数据之间存在的整体逻辑关系。网络模型南方彩电民主洗衣机银河电冰箱4700170045001800200018002100描述事物之间较为复杂的关系,反映客观事物之间多对多的联系商店:价格:商品:关系模型用二维表结构来表示实体及实体之间联系的模型。以关系数学理论为基础,操作的对象和结果都是二维表。关系(二维表)男张智忠学号姓名性别党员专业出生年月助学金990001王涛男No物理82-01-21¥160.00990002庄前女Yes物理82-09-21¥200.0099010
5、1丁保华男No数学81-04-18¥180.00990102姜沛棋女No数学81-12-02¥280.00No数学80-08-06¥240.00990201程玲女Yes计算机82-11-14¥200.00990202黎敏艳女Yes计算机83-02-21¥160.00990103关系数据库关系数据模型域学号姓名990001王涛990002庄前990101丁保华990102姜沛棋党员NoYesNoNo助学金¥160.00¥200.00¥180.00¥280.00主关键字元组属性关系外部关键字二.关系的
6、特点关系必须规范化每个属性必须是不可分隔的数据单元。3.关系中不允许有完全相同的元组,即冗余4.同一关系中元组的次序无关紧要5.在一个关系中列的次序无关紧要.2.在同一关系中不能出现相同的属性名.关系运算传统的集合运算并交差专门的关系运算选择:从关系中找出满足给定条件的元组的操作。投影:从关系模式中指定若干属性组成新的关系。联接:将两个关系模式做横向结合,生成的新关系包含满足联接条件的元组。自然联接:联接运算中,按照字段值对应相等为条件的,去掉重复属性的等值联接。数据库设计基础数据库设计原则关系数
7、据库的设计应遵从概念单一化“一事一地”的原则2.避免在表之间出现重复字段3.表中的字段必须是原始数据和基本数据元素4.用外部关键字保证有关联的表之间的联系创建数据库数据库设计步骤分析建立数据库的目的确定数据库中的表确定表中的字段确定表之间的关系确定主关键字确定表之间的关系设计求精1、用二维表来表示实体及实体之间联系的数据模型是A)实体—联系模型B)层次模型C)网状模型D)关系模型2、数据库DB、数据库系统DBS、数据库管理系统DBMS3者之间的关系是A)DBS包括DB和DBMSB)DBMS包括DB
8、和DBSC)DB包括DBS和DBMSD)DBS就是DB,即是DBMS3、在Access中,通过()来管理信息。A)数据库对象B)组C)数据表D)模块选择填空6、数据库系统的核心是()A)数据模型B)软件工具C)数据库管理系统D)数据库7、在数据库中能够惟一地标识一个元组的属性或属性的组合称为A)记录B)字段C)域D)关键字5、关系数据库的基本操作是()A)增加、删除和修改B)选择、投影和联接C)创建、打开和关闭D)索引、查询和统计8、为了合理组织数据,应遵从的设计原则是A)“一事一
此文档下载收益归作者所有